Popularity analysis
The name Denija has seen a steady yet fluctuating presence among newborns in the United States from 2001 to 2005. During this period, there were a total of 31 births with this name.
In 2001, Denija made its mark on the baby naming scene with eight newborns sharing the name. This number decreased slightly in 2002, with only five babies being named Denija that year. However, it rebounded to eight births again in 2003.
The years 2004 and 2005 saw a consistent trend, with five newborns each year being named Denija. This stability in the number of births indicates that while not extremely popular, Denija remained a recognizable choice for parents during this time period.
